Graying Clover vs Rio Grande Clover
Trifolium canescens compared with Trifolium riograndense
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Graying Clover | Rio Grande Clover |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(planta) | Plantae (planta)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order same |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) |
| Family same | Fabaceae | Fabaceae |
| Genus same | Trifolium | Trifolium |
| Species | Trifolium canescens | Trifolium riograndense |
Evolutionary Relationship
Graying Clover and Rio Grande Clover share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Trifolium.
